Toyota to host Business After Hours on Oct. 25
Team members work in transmission assembly on Friday, Feb. 25, 2011, at Toyota Motor Manufacturing West Virginia in Buffalo. Yoji "Yogi" Suzuki, president of Toyota West Virginia, announced a $64 million expansion project during a ceremony on Friday.
Purchase this photoBUFFALO -- The next Business After Hours sponsored by the Putnam County Chamber of Commerce will take place at Toyota Motor Manufacturing WV Inc. It will be from 5 to 7 p.m. Thursday, Oct. 25, at 1 Sugar Maple Lane in Buffalo.
The chamber asks guests to arrive at least 15 minutes early.
Business After Hours events provide a social but professional venue for business people to make new contacts and expand their presence in the business community. Food and refreshments are included.
Participation is open to all chamber members and their guests. The cost to attend is $15 per person. RSVPs are required by Oct. 23, by calling 304-757-6510 or emailing chamber@putnamcounty.org. Pre-payment is appreciated.
There will be a cash drawing sponsored by BB&T valued at $1,000, but winners must be present. The chamber identifies future Business of the Month winners from the calling cards of those in attendance.
